Abstract

Older investment and risk management systems are struggling with rising market volatility, increased indignity of rules practice, and a rapid rate of technological advances. This paper will discuss the possibilities of combining predictive analysis with agile product delivery approaches to streamline systems' responsiveness and improve decision-making practices between various industries in the financial and energy domains. Based on a thorough literature review, framework development, and case studies, we suggest a four-step framework for systematically integrating predictive intelligence into agile workflows. When transferring to energy sector investment systems, this system has shown improved adaptability, shorter iteration cycles, better anticipation of risk, and enhanced fit-gap between technical capacity and business goals. The results indicate that agile-predictive integration is a strategic need of companies that work in an environment of uncertainty and where data-intensive operations do not respond to traditional developmental strategies.
